Many of us are chasing the end result as fast as we can, disregarding the inevitable steps that it will take to get there. 

When I was younger, I could care less about character development. I didn’t want to hear anything about the process of becoming. 

I wanted what I wanted and I wanted it yesterday. 

The problem with this type of thinking is that when the going gets tough, it’s easier to start negotiating with yourself. 

It becomes logical to make excuses as to why it’s not worth it anymore and that quitting makes sense. 

When we focus on the process, we understand that it’s a journey which will forge the character needed to get to the next level.

Only when we appreciate the process of becoming do we internalize that the end result is just one finish line among many on our adventure through life.
